On August 6, the Ministry of Land, Infrastructure, and Transport in South Korea released an announcement, indicating that Hyundai Motor, Kia, Stellantis, and Honda will proactively initiate a recall of more than 512,000 vehicles within South Korea. This recall effort aims to address and rectify faulty components. The affected lineup spans 13 distinct models, encompassing the Hyundai Tucson SUV, Kia K8, Jeep Cherokee SUV, and Honda Odyssey MPV, among others.
